Located in the scenic East Riding area of Yorkshire, Beverley was once voted one of the best places to live in the UK and is renowned for its rich heritage, historic buildings and medieval skyline.

Beverley is steeped in history and remains wonderfully unspoiled. The beautiful town offers its local residents a range of boutique cafes, superb restaurants, terrific pubs and award winning walks. The cobbled streets and surrounding rolling hills form the perfect setting for Beverley's famous local market, which offers such attractions as fresh local produce, flourishing nursery plants and delicious home bakes for the residents and visitors. It’s a town that tells a fascinating story, with local legends and community culture very much embedded in this small settlement.

Magnificent churches

The Beverly Minster is one of the main attractions of this town, known for its exquisite gothic style. It is the largest Church of England Parish Church. Founded in 700 AD, the current building was completed in 1400. 

The Minster contains three styles: Early English, Decorated and Perpendicular, with many who visit this church today experiencing a sense of calm and spiritual peace within its walls.

For lovers of ecclesiastical buildings, St Mary's Church is also well worth a visit. It was constructed in the 12th Century with many later restorations up to and including work by Pugin and Gilbert Scott in the 19th Century. 

The ceiling has 40 Kings painted on it, some historic and some probably mythical. There may also be an Alice in Wonderland connection with a stone 'white rabbit' carved into a door frame.

Historic and cultural delights

To get a wonderful overview of Beverley's history and cultural life, the Treasure House is a one-stop centre for heritage and information services, providing access to the collections of the East Riding Archives, Beverley Art Gallery, Beverley Guildhall and archaeology of the Museums Service under one roof. The Treasure House opened in 2007, which supported by a £3.9m from the Heritage Lottery Fund Incidentally, the tower also offers views across the town of Beverley.
